c语言编程完了再怎么做

时间:2025-01-27 23:47:47 网络游戏

完成C语言编程题目后,可以采取以下步骤来进一步提高自己的编程能力和解决问题的能力:

总结和复习:

回顾所做的编程题目,总结其中的知识点和解题思路。可以将每个题目的解题思路、关键代码和遇到的问题记录下来,形成一个笔记或者总结文档。这样有助于巩固所学知识,并且方便以后回顾和复习。

深入学习:

C语言是一门非常广泛应用的编程语言,刷完题目后可以选择深入学习C语言的高级特性和相关的编程技巧。例如,可以学习C语言的指针、动态内存管理、文件操作等内容。还可以学习C语言的一些常用库函数和常见的算法。

实践项目:

通过实践项目来巩固所学的C语言编程知识。可以选择一些小型的项目,例如编写一个简单的计算器、图书管理系统等,来应用所学的知识。通过实践项目可以提高编程能力和解决问题的能力。

阅读C语言相关的书籍和资料:

除了刷编程题目,阅读C语言相关的书籍和资料也是提高编程能力的一种方法。可以选择一些经典的C语言教材和编程指南,深入理解C语言的特性和使用方法。

参与开源项目或者社区讨论:

参与开源项目或者加入C语言相关的社区讨论,可以与其他开发者交流学习,了解更多实际应用和开发经验。在开源项目中贡献自己的代码或者解决问题,可以提高自己的编程能力和团队协作能力。

学习其他编程语言:

学完C语言之后,可以考虑继续学习其他编程语言,如Java、Python等,这些语言都是非常流行和实用的编程语言。

学习数据结构和算法:

掌握数据结构和算法是编程的基础,它们是解决问题的重要工具。可以学习一些常见的数据结构,如数组、链表、栈、队列、树、图等,并学习常见的算法,如排序、查找、递归、动态规划等。

学习面向对象编程语言:

C语言是一种过程式编程语言,而面向对象编程(OOP)是一种更高级的编程范式。通过学习OOP语言,如Java、Python、C++等,你将能够更好地组织和管理代码,并使用封装、继承和多态等概念来提高代码的可读性和复用性。

学习数据库和网络编程:

了解数据库的基本概念和常用操作可以让你更好地处理数据。学习SQL语言和关系型数据库(如MySQL或Oracle)可以让你掌握数据存储和检索的技能。学习网络编程可以让你开发出基于网络的应用程序,如客户端-服务器应用、网络游戏等。

学习操作系统和软件工程:

深入了解操作系统的原理和机制可以帮助你更好地理解计算机系统的工作原理,以及如何优化程序的执行效率。学习操作系统相关知识,如进程管理、内存管理和文件系统等,可以提高你对计算机系统的整体把控能力。学习软件工程可以帮助你更好地管理和组织大型软件项目。

通过以上步骤,你可以全面提升自己的编程能力和解决问题的能力,为未来的学习和工作打下坚实的基础。